April is School Library Month.
We are having a Name That Book Contest to celebrate. Every morning in April the first lines of a book will be posted here, announced over the intercom, and written on the media center whiteboard. Students and staff, enter your answer each day at the link below, or come to the media center to enter. All correct answers will be entered in a weekly drawing. Student winners will get a prize from Mrs. Hill's prize box and staff winners will get one day of duty free lunch. At the end of the month, all correct answers will be entered in a drawing for an Amazon gift card. One student and one staff will win.
